Android Studio अतिथि 7 सेकंड में ऑनलाइन नहीं आया है


89

जब मैं पहली बार एंड्रॉइड स्टूडियो में एमुलेटर शुरू करता हूं तो मुझे एक सूचना संदेश मिलता है,

अतिथि 7 सेकंड में ऑनलाइन नहीं आ रहा है

मैं इसे रोकने के लिए उत्सुक हूं क्योंकि यह लगभग 40 सेकंड के लिए मेरी स्क्रीन पर है जबकि मैं एमुलेटर में कुछ भी नहीं कर सकता।

जवाबों:


78

मुझे भी यही समस्या थी। AVD मैनेजर में कोल्ड बूट नाउ का चयन करने से समस्या हल होती है।

लेकिन मुझे हर बार एवीडी मैनेजर खोलना होता है जब मैं एमुलेटर को लॉन्च करना चाहता हूं और मैं एवीडी मैनेजर को खोले बिना रन ऐप बटन और सिलेक्ट डिवाइस पर क्लिक करना चाहता हूं।

इसे हल करने के लिए: AVD प्रबंधक खोलें -> डिवाइस संपादित करें -> उन्नत सेटिंग दिखाएं -> बूट विकल्प -> त्वरित बूट के बजाय कोल्ड बूट चुनें।


2
मैं बूट विकल्प नहीं देख सकता। वर्तमान में एंड्रॉइड स्टूडियो 3.1.2 का उपयोग कर रहा है। : /
बी-एफजी

@ बी-एफजी स्ट्रेंज। मैंने अपने एएस में जांच की है, बूट विकल्प उपलब्ध हैं।
शोधकर्ता

अजीब। मुझे पुनः स्थापित करने की आवश्यकता हो सकती है।
बी-एफजी

@ b-fg आप किस एंड्रॉइड एमुलेटर का उपयोग करते हैं?
शोधकर्ता

1
Android स्टूडियो में एक। मैं @Boris उत्तर के रूप में कोल्ड बूट चला सकता हूं लेकिन इसे नए वर्चुअल डिवाइस पर कॉन्फ़िगर नहीं कर सकता। कोई बात नहीं।
बी-एफजी

100

वास्तव में 'कोल्ड बूट नाउ' इस स्थिति में काम कर सकता है कोल्ड बूट नाउ विकल्प दिखा एमुलेटर एक्शन मेनू के साथ एवीडी प्रबंधक


आप .iniअपनी ~/.android/avdनिर्देशिका में फ़ाइलों के माध्यम से ऐसा कैसे करते हैं ?
च्लोए

1
emulator @_avd_name_ -no-snapshot-loadकमांड लाइन से कोल्ड बूट करने के लिए उपयोग करें ।
च्लोए

1
हर बार किया जाता है तो ही काम करता है। यदि कोल्ड बूट विकल्प का चयन नहीं किया जाता है तो हर बार समस्या बनी रहती है।
जिंजु

यह एक तय की तरह लगता है, लेकिन मैं वास्तव में यह कैसे समझा नहीं देख रहा हूँ।
१०:४

कमांड के माध्यम से एमुलेटर चलाते समय मुझे यह चेतावनी (या त्रुटि) मिल रही है ... क्या कोल्ड बूट के लिए कोई झंडा है?
डेपन कुमार



4

मैं .iniफ़ाइल को मैन्युअल रूप से अद्यतन करके इस समस्या को हल करने में कामयाब रहा । (मैं जीयूआई में एक संगत सेटिंग खोजने में सक्षम नहीं था।)

.iniफ़ाइल का स्थान , आपकी होम निर्देशिका के सापेक्ष है:

~/.android/avd/MyDevice.avd/config.ini

जहाँ MyDeviceकॉन्फ़िगर डिवाइस नाम को संदर्भित करता है।

आपके ऑपरेटिंग सिस्टम के आधार पर, आप https://en.wikipedia.org/wiki/Home_directory के अनुसार अपनी होम डायरेक्टरी पा सकते हैं ।

भीतर प्रवेश बदले config.iniसे noकरने के लिए yes:

fastboot.forceColdBoot=yes

2
  1. मैंने 1536 Mbyte के बजाय AVD मेमोरी 2048 Mbyte निर्दिष्ट किया। चीजें फिर से काम करने लगीं। (मैं मैकबुक पर विकसित कर रहा हूं।)
  2. मैंने "कुलदीप चंदेल" समाधान की कोशिश की, जो एवीडी की नकल करना है और मेरा ऐप फिर से चलता है। उसके कारण मैंने RAM को 1536 Mbyte के रूप में फिर से निर्दिष्ट किया। क्या लगता है ... यह काम किया ...

मुझे लगता है कि एवीडी चीजों को संभालने के लिए भ्रमित करता है और हमें वर्तमान एवीडी की नकल करने की जरूरत है, और समस्याग्रस्त के बजाय इसका उपयोग करें।


1

"आपका वायरल डिवाइस" में - अपने डिवाइस को डुप्लिकेट या डुप्लिकेट पर क्लिक करें। यह आकर्षण की तरह काम करेगा।


1

मुझे एंड्रॉइड स्टूडियो 3.0.1 के साथ एंड्रॉइड एपीआई 28 एमुलेटर का उपयोग करने पर इस मुद्दे का सामना करना पड़ा। Android API 28 के लिए स्टूडियो 3.1 और इसके बाद के संस्करण की आवश्यकता है। एक बार जब मैंने स्टूडियो को 3.1.4 और एंड्रॉइड एमुलेटर को नवीनतम संस्करण में अपडेट किया, तो यह काम कर गया।


0

एंड्रॉइड डिवाइस मैनेजर से समस्या डिवाइस के लिए डिफ़ॉल्ट सेटिंग्स सेट करना मेरे लिए समस्या हल हो गई।

हमारी साइट का प्रयोग करके, आप स्वीकार करते हैं कि आपने हमारी Cookie Policy और निजता नीति को पढ़ और समझा लिया है।
Licensed under cc by-sa 3.0 with attribution required.